**Biography of Eileen Agar Collage**

Eileen Agar was a renowned British artist born on December 2, 1899, in Buenos Aires, Argentina. She later settled in London, where she developed her artistic career. Agar studied at the Westminster School of Art and the Slade School of Fine Art, acquiring a diverse skill set that would inform her creative practices. Her multicultural upbringing and exposure to various artistic movements significantly influenced her work, particularly her interest in Surrealism and abstraction.
